  • Support audio et vidéo HTML5

    10 avril 2011

    MediaSPIP utilise les balises HTML5 video et audio pour la lecture de documents multimedia en profitant des dernières innovations du W3C supportées par les navigateurs modernes.
    Pour les navigateurs plus anciens, le lecteur flash Flowplayer est utilisé.
    Le lecteur HTML5 utilisé a été spécifiquement créé pour MediaSPIP : il est complètement modifiable graphiquement pour correspondre à un thème choisi.
    Ces technologies permettent de distribuer vidéo et son à la fois sur des ordinateurs conventionnels (...)

  • FFMPEG - adding a nullsrc causes my script to report "1000 duplicate frames"

    14 juin 2020, par rossmcm

    I'm trying to add coloured rectangle highlights to a video, appearing at different locations and times. The highlights are on a 6x6 grid of 320x180 rectangles.

    



    Originally I didn't have the nullsrc=size=1920x1080 thinking that it would start with an empty image, but it seems that that causes it to make assumptions about where the input is coming from. So I added the nullsrc=size=1920x1080 to start with a transparent 1920x1080 image but this command returns a warning that 1000 duplicate frames have been produced and it keeps going past the end of the input video with no signs of stopping.

    



    ffmpeg -y \       
  -i "Input.mp4" \           
  -filter_complex \ 
 "nullsrc=size=1920x1080, drawbox=x=(3-1)*320:y=(3-1)*180:w=320:h=180:t=7:c=cyan,   fade=in:st=10:d=1:alpha=1, fade=out:st=40:d=1:alpha=1[tmp1]; \
  nullsrc=size=1920x1080, drawbox=x=(4-1)*320:y=(4-1)*180:w=320:h=180:t=7:c=blue,   fade=in:st=20:d=1:alpha=1, fade=out:st=50:d=1:alpha=1[tmp2]; \
  nullsrc=size=1920x1080, drawbox=x=(5-1)*320:y=(5-1)*180:w=320:h=180:t=7:c=green,  fade=in:st=30:d=1:alpha=1, fade=out:st=60:d=1:alpha=1[tmp3]; \
  nullsrc=size=1920x1080, drawbox=x=(6-1)*320:y=(6-1)*180:w=320:h=180:t=7:c=yellow, fade=in:st=40:d=1:alpha=1, fade=out:st=70:d=1:alpha=1[tmp4]; \
  [tmp1][tmp2] overlay=0:0[ovr1]; \ 
  [tmp3][tmp4] overlay=0:0[ovr2]; \ 
  [ovr1][ovr2] overlay=0:0[boxes]; \ 
  [0:v][boxes] overlay=0:0" \        
  "Output.mp4"


    



    The input video is around 01:45 long. Log of run :

  • How to make HLS start from the begining

    15 septembre 2020, par Ariel Argañaraz

    I need some help with HLS streaming, I'm trying to create a playlist for streaming,

    



    I'm using ffmpeg to generate the files and the .m3u8 files. And for playing i'm using a web page with videojs player

    



    The idea is to simulate a live streaming using files already created.

    



    The problem is that in some version of iphone works and in another does not work.
The problem is that when I start play the video in the Safari browser of my phone it freezes for a while and then download and play the last segment.

    



    for example if the video is split in 4 differents .ts files.
It starts playing from the 4th .ts file and then stop.

    



    The problem is that I have 2 iphone mobile phone, one of them works perfectly but the other one not

    



    The not working cell phone is a iphone 6 (version 9.2.1)

    



    Here is my m3u8 file. Note that I'm using the #EXT-X-PLAYLIST-TYPE:EVENT and I remove the #EXT-X-ENDLIST from the botton. So it should be played as an live streaming.

    



    It works for another phones, it begins from the 0 second when I set the #EXT-X-START:TIME-OFFSET=0

    



    but in this version (9.2.1) the video freezes and then jumps to the last segment (webinar-3.ts) plays that segment and finally stop.

    



    #EXTM3U
#EXT-X-VERSION:4
#EXT-X-MEDIA-SEQUENCE:0
#EXT-X-ALLOW-CACHE:NO
#EXT-X-PLAYLIST-TYPE:EVENT
#EXT-X-START:TIME-OFFSET=0
#EXT-X-TARGETDURATION:6
#EXTINF:5.046444,
webinar-0.ts
#EXTINF:5,
webinar-1.ts
#EXTINF:5,
webinar-2.ts
#EXTINF:5,
webinar-3.ts


    



    Have anybody got an idea of what i'm doing wrong or how to get a m3u8 config that works for this iphone version ?
